Our capabilities

The ARPCO capabilities provided for a Computer Room Design project include Planning & Feasibility and Design & Engineering as follows:

  • Key Design Criteria (KDC) Development Establish Load, Availability, and Deployment Density Design Criteria
  • Site Surveys Survey the Existing Conditions to Establish Facility Constraints
  • Assessment Services Establish Recommendations for Upgrade and/or Improvement
  • Conceptual Design with CFD Modeling Establish a Visual Representation of the Recommendations and Verify Design Considerations using CFD Models
  • Project Cost Estimating Establish a Project Cost Estimate Including All Hardware, Labor, and Professional Services
  • Preliminary Master Project Schedule Development Establish a Preliminary Schedule to Understand the Project Timeline
  • Architectural & Engineering Design Plan and Engineer Room, Floor, Physical Security, and Other Intrinsic Elements Using Design Approaches Necessary for Mission Critical Facilities

Successful computer room design entails a thorough understanding of both facility and IT design requirements. PTS leverages its integrated IT and facility planning and engineering expertise and experience to create a facility that supports the IT load while being energy efficient and highly maintainable.

ARPCO’s programs for mission critical facility development begin by identifying the key design criteria (KDCs) for the two (2) main areas of the project focus within the facility: the Technology Infrastructure (IT) and the Support Infrastructure (the Facility). The following table provides a look at how ARPCO maps the KDCs against availability requirements, power & cooling density, and overall business objectives. It is through a thorough understanding of the project’s KDCs that allow ARPCO to ultimately provide an effective, always available computer or server room facility within a client budget window.

ARPCO’s  Approach

ARPCO approach begins with a thorough planning & feasibility phase prior to implementation of architectural and engineering services. This approach leverages the first four phases of the ARPCO data center project process for successful planning leading into cohesive design services which support client requirements.
